Profile
Supplies dimensional, materials, and chemical metrology systems plus software and support to semiconductor manufacturers. Direct customer relationships span process development through production, with customers centered in Asian chipmaking markets and operations shaped by industry spending, export controls, and a limited group of large customers.
Measures semiconductor wafers with dimensional, materials, and chemical metrology systems, alongside modeling and fleet-management software. Inline and stand-alone tools support logic, foundry, memory, and advanced-packaging production.
Direct relationships with chipmakers connect process development to high-volume production support, while related services complement product sales. Customers are concentrated across Taiwan, Japan, South Korea, China, and the United States, and manufacturing spans Israel, the United States, and Germany.
Growth beyond optical dimensional measurement came through materials and chemical capabilities, then modular platforms for advanced packaging. The business depends on semiconductor capital spending, a limited group of large customers, export controls, regional conditions in Israel, and principal facilities and suppliers for each product line.
